Carpet & Upholstery FAQs

The cost for carpet cleaning and upholstery cleaning services can vary depending on factors such as the size of the area, level of staining, and type of material. Nationwide, carpet cleaning typically ranges from $120 to $250 for up to three rooms. On the other hand, professional upholstery cleaning costs an average of $50 to $200 per piece, with larger items like sectional sofas skewing toward the higher end. Some companies may offer package deals for both services, which can save you money. Always check if the price includes extras like stain protection or deodorization to avoid surprise charges.

Most professionals recommend having carpets cleaned every 12 to 18 months, depending on foot traffic, pets, or asthma/allergy concerns. Upholstery, on the other hand, should generally be cleaned every 1 to 2 years, or more frequently if you notice visible stains, odors, or discoloration. Scheduling regular cleanings not only keeps your home looking fresh but also extends the lifespan of your furnishings.

Yes, most professional carpet cleaning services use child- and pet-safe solutions. Many providers offer options for eco-friendly and non-toxic cleaning solutions designed to remove dirt without leaving harmful residues. However, it's always a good idea to ask your carpet cleaning professional for details on the products they use beforehand. If you're concerned about chemicals, look for companies that specialize in green cleaning solutions.

Be aware of these common red flags:

  • Extremely low pricing: While attractive, it might lead to poor service or hidden fees.
  • Lack of proof of insurance: This could leave you liable in case of damages.
  • No online reviews or testimonials: A lack of reviews may indicate inexperience.
  • Vague answers: Professionals should clearly explain their process and costs.

Always trust your gut—if a company seems unprofessional, move on to a more transparent provider.

Drying times can vary based on the cleaning method used. Steam cleaning (hot water extraction), a common method for carpets, usually requires 6 to 12 hours to dry completely. Some modern cleaning techniques, like low-moisture or encapsulation methods, may have a much shorter drying time of around 1 to 4 hours. Upholstery drying time tends to range from 2 to 8 hours, depending on fabric and humidity levels. To speed up the process, ensure proper ventilation and use fans where possible.

Home carpet cleaning machines can tackle light staining and refresh carpets, but they often lack the power and heat necessary to provide a deep, thorough clean like a professional service. For instance:

  • Professionals use industrial-grade equipment capable of removing embedded dirt and allergens.
  • DIY machines might leave carpets overly wet, increasing the risk of mold or mildew.

While DIY cleaning is useful for maintenance, professional cleaning is recommended for heavily soiled carpets or every 12-18 months.

In many cases, professional cleaning companies may move light furniture such as chairs or small tables as part of their service. However, large or heavy items like beds, sectional sofas, and bookcases are typically not included. To prep your home, remove smaller obstacles, and look for a company that communicates clear expectations about furniture handling in advance. If you're unsure, ask them what you need to do before they arrive.

While carpet cleaning services may not be required to hold a specific license, certification is often a sign of professionalism. Look for companies with certifications from the Institute of Inspection Cleaning and Restoration Certification (IICRC) or similar organizations. These certifications indicate that the company follows industry best practices. To learn more, visit the IICRC website. Additionally, always check with your local municipality or state regulations to confirm any local requirements.
